KKR Invests in BookMyShow to Fuel Live Entertainment Growth

By Media Infotainment Team | Wednesday, 19 August 2026

Investment firm KKR has acquired a minority stake in live entertainment platform BookMyShow, in a move set to support the company's next phase of growth as it scales its live entertainment business and deepens its full-stack offering across India.

Established in 2007, BookMyShow has evolved from a ticketing platform into a full-stack entertainment company, combining technology, consumer reach and deep industry capabilities across movies, live entertainment and experiences.

BookMyShow Live Emerges as a Key Growth Driver

In recent times, BookMyShow Live has emerged as a key component of the company's overall business growth. The company's live entertainment division operates across the entire value chain - from talent and IP acquisition to production, promotion, partnerships and audience development.

Akshay Tanna, Partner and Head of India Private Equity at KKR, said BookMyShow has been a pioneer in delivering high-quality entertainment experiences in India. He added that KKR is pleased to support the company as it leads the next phase of growth in India's out-of-home entertainment sector, and believes BookMyShow will play an important role in advancing India's ambition to become a global entertainment hub and a premier destination for leading artists and acts from around the world. Tanna said KKR looks forward to combining its deep local knowledge with its global investment experience and network to support BookMyShow's next stage of transformation.

Through sustained investment in the ecosystem, BookMyShow Live has built the capabilities and scale to bring increasingly ambitious entertainment experiences to India, while contributing to the development of a more robust and commercially viable live entertainment market in the country.

KKR Expands Its India and Global Media Portfolio

With this investment, KKR has further expanded its portfolio across a range of sectors in India, which now includes Medicover India, a multi-speciality hospital chain; Lighthouse Learning, a leading Indian education services provider; Vini Cosmetics, a personal care and beauty products company; Healthcare Global Enterprises, a leading oncology hospital chain; Darwinbox, an HR technology platform; and Rebel Foods, an internet restaurant company.

BookMyShow also adds to KKR's global portfolio of media and entertainment investments, which includes Internet Brands, ByteDance, Chord Music Partners, Epic Games, PlayOnSports, OverDrive, Superstruct and Simon & Schuster.

Ashish Hemrajani, Founder and CEO of BookMyShow, said the company is delighted to welcome KKR as an investor, adding that its global perspective, deep expertise and strong understanding of consumer businesses will be invaluable as BookMyShow enters its next phase of growth. He noted that the timing of the investment is particularly significant, given the company's expanded presence across the live entertainment landscape and the fast-growing opportunity within India's broader entertainment economy. Hemrajani also expressed gratitude to BookMyShow's longstanding investors - Network18 (part of Reliance Industries Limited), Accel Partners, Elevation Capital, Stripes Group and TPG - for their continued support.
